ASP_net012基于_net的城市公交查询系统(论文和程序)
| ASP_net012基于_net的城市公交查询系统(论文和程序)-系统图片展示 |
| ASP_net012基于_net的城市公交查询系统(论文和程序)-包括论文和程序列表 |
包括目录名称:
ASP_net012基于_net的城市公交查询系统(论文和程序) - 2 文件数, 1 目录数.
包括目录名称:
基于.NET的城市公交查询系统 - 0 文件数, 0 目录数.
..\基于.NET的城市公交查询系统.rar
..\基于.NET的城市公交查询系统55.doc
| ASP_net012基于_net的城市公交查询系统(论文和程序)-论文部分内容 |
基于.NET的城市公交查询系统55-部分内容分类号:TP312UDC:D10621-408-(2007)5798-0
密级:公开编号:2003211020
基于.NET的城市公交查询系统
论文作者学位专业:
网络工程
申请学位类别:
工学学士
指导教师(职称):
王翔
论文提交日期:
2007年6月10日
基于.NET的城市公交查询系统
摘要
随着Internet的快速发展,互联网已成为人们快速获取、发布和传递信息的重要渠道,显然它已成为社会生活的一部分。但我国的城市公交信息查询却还处于比较落后的水平上,广大的市民获取路线信息方式也比较少,最常用的方式只局限在询问和交通地图上。而城市公交查询系统就是使人们能够在因特网上方便、简单的查询出各条路线,了解自己所经过的每个站点等信息,以便能更好的制定自己的行动计划而设计的。它主要实现的模块是公交信息的查询模块,其中包括的功能有:线路查询、站点查询、站站查询、车站查询;而系统管理模块主要实现的是对各个数据表进行添加、编辑、删除等功能操作以及对留言版进行一些相应的回复。
城市公交查询系统开发技术采用的是基于.NET的B/S架构,它的前端选用ASP.NET为主要的编程框架,其.ASPX文件包含组成用户界面的HTML文本和控件,而后台选用了C#编程语言。用.NET编程的最大好处在于易于管理和重用性比较高。数据库选用的是SQLServer2000,而应用程序通过ADO.NET与SQLServer2000数据库建立链接,并且运用SQL语言实现对其数据库进行操作。在此系统中,大量采用了存储过程来对数据库进行操作。
关键词:互联网;城市公交查询;.NET;存储过程
TheDesignandRealizationofCityBusInquirySystemBasedon.NET
Abstract
WiththerapiddevelopmentofInternet,theInternethasbecomeanimportantchannelofpeopleacquiring,publishingandtransmittinginformationandobviouslybecomeonepartofsociallife.ButChina'stechnologyofurbanpublictransportinformationinquiryisstillinarelativelybackwardlevel.Thenumerouscitizenshavealittleaccesstoacquiretheinformationaboutbuslines.Themostcommonwaysareconfinedtotrafficmapsorthereferencetostranger.AndtheurbanpublictransportsystemisdesignedforpeopletoinquireofalllinesintheInternetconvenientlyandsimplyandgettoknoweverysitethattheypassedawayinordertomaketheirplansmoreefficiently.Themainmoduleofthissystemisthebusinformationquerymodule.Itsfunctionsincludelineinquiry,siteinquiry,station-to-stationinquiryandstationinquiry.Thesystemmanagementmodulemainlyrealizesthefunctionaloperationonadding,editing,deletingofalldatatablesandresponsestothemessagecorrespondingly.
ThedevelopmenttechnologyofthecitybusinquirysystemadoptB/Sframeworkbasedon.NET.Itsfront-endpartusesASP.NETasthemajorframework.The.ASPXfilecontainsHTMLtextandcontrolswhichmakeupofuserinterface.Theback-endchoosesC#asitsprogramminglanguage.Thegreatestbenefitofchoosing.NETtoprogrammingistheeasymanagementsandreusability.DatabaseusestheSQLServer2000,andtheapplicationaccessesthedatabasebyADO.NETandusesSQLlanguagetooperatethedatabase.Thestoredprocedureisusedalottooperatethedatabaseinthesystem.
Keywords:Internet;CityBusinquiries;.NET;StoredProcedure.
目录
论文总页数:26页
1引言 1
1.1城市公交查询系统的前景 1
1.2城市公交查询系统的作用 2
2城市公交查询系统的实现技术和工具 2
2.1ASP.NET 2
2.1.1什么是ASP.NET 2
2.1.2.NETFramework概述 2
2.1.3ASP.NET的特点 3
2.2C# 4
2.3ADO.NET对象操作数据库 4
2.4SQLServer2000 5
2.5MicrosoftVisualStudio.NET 5
3城市公交车查询系统的分析与设计 5
3.1需求分析 5
3.2概要设计 6
3.2.1系统功能描述 6
3.2.2系统功能模块划分 6
3.2.3系统流程设计 8
3.2.4系统E-R图 10
4数据库结构设计与实现 12
4.1数据表的创建 12
4.2数据库的连接 13
4.3存储过程 14
5城市公交查询系统的实现 15
5.1系统首页 15
5.2后台管理界面 18
6系统测试 23
6.1测试用户查询模块 23
6.2测试系统管理模块 23
6.3测试留言簿管理 24
结论 25
参考文献 25
致谢 26
声明 27
1引言
当今是一个以网络为中心的信息化世界,计算机已成为广大市民不可缺少的工具。由于我国城市化进程的推进,目前城市不断地在向郊区延伸,边缘不断扩大,和郊区的边界甚至开始变得模糊化,城市公交路线不断地增多,加之众多公交路线时常调整,目前众多市民,特别是一些大中型城市的市民,对各条公交路线的信息不清楚或掌握得不准确。并且当今各大城市的家庭轿车相继增多,使城市交通出现拥堵现象。而公共交通与其它交通方式相比具有人均占用道路少、能源消耗低、运输成本低、污染相对较小、客运量大,运送效率高等优点,它是解决大、中城市交通拥堵等交通问题,所以各大城市都在积极地发展公共交通的运用。本毕业设计主要的目的就是实现公交查询以及信息发布。
本设计的预期成果是:此系统能够使用户简单的查询出他们自己想要的车次经过哪些站点,在哪一站可以转乘,然后继续换乘哪路车;也可以预先知道可以通过哪些车次可以到达目的地。在留言版中可以留下用户对系统的任何信息或者任何要求,管理员可以通过对留言版信息的解读对系统进行一系列的修改。
1.1城市公交查询系统的前景
近十几年来,我国汽车工业蓬勃发展,特别是家用轿车的增长。发展中国家用轿车市场,其规模与速度必须与城市基础建设同步,如果一味追求发展速度,势必将造成很多大城市严重的交通堵塞问题,而且还将给社会带来一系列不良后果,如加大社会经济成本,增加能源消耗,恶化城市空气,增加交通事故等等。因此,在发展我国的汽车工业的同时要注意到城市公共交通存在的意义和作用,加大国家在公共交通方面的投入,全面规划、统筹安排、合理配置、科学管理,使城市道路流畅、方便、安全、有效、可靠。
然而,随着公共交通的快速发展,会逐渐地出现越来越多的公共汽车和不同的公交路线,这样会使人们对各条公交路线的信息掌握的不是很清楚。而城市公交查询系统主要任务就在于对各条路线的信息查询,和对整个公交线路信息进行相关的管理。使用公交查询系统人们就可以找出一条最适合于
上一篇:
ASP_net011图书馆管理信息系统(论文和程序)
下一篇:
国家教育公平政策的思路、问题与对策